Mumbai (Maharashtra) [India], April 1 (ANI): The credit ratio of India Inc declined in the second half of fiscal 2026, even as the overall credit outlook for the FY27 remains stable but cautious due to the ongoing West Asia conflict, noted Crisil Ratings in its latest projections. The credit ratio of Indian companies, which measures the proportion of rating upgrades to downgrades, stood at 1.50 times in the second half of FY26, moderating from 2.17 times in the first half. New Delhi, Apr 1 (PTI) Corporate credit profiles remained resilient in 2025-26, with rating upgrades significantly outpacing downgrades, reflecting healthy balance sheets, steady domestic demand, and continued policy support, ICRA said on Wednesday. During FY26, ICRA upgraded 388 entities compared to 124 downgrades, resulting in a strong credit ratio of 3.1 times, a notable improvement from 2 times in FY25 and 2.1 times in FY24.
